Luu Hai Minh, CEO of Orange Informatics Communication (OIC) - also known as Nhat Hai Project Technology Joint Stock Company - always has great aspirations and ambition to reach the peak of technological possibilities. He has successfully built OIC into a leading ICT brand.
Unique business management strategies
Since OIC was established on October 13, 1997, CEO Luu Hai Minh has carried out many unique business strategies. He has focused on researching, developing and diversifying the different areas under the OIC brand. All products and services of the company are branded OIC like OIComputer, OICabinet Rack, OIC Hospital Software, OIC Security Software, OIC Treepro and OICare.
Visiting OIC headquarters, we were amazed at military-style working unit titles, like Operations Command and Advising Division. The combat-inspired terminology is to remind all employees to wholeheartedly devote themselves to the development of the company. In his viewpoint, the marketplace is a battlefield and each business activity is comparable to preparing for or fighting a battle.
OIC has adopted the Blue Ocean Strategy, avoiding head-to-head competition with big businesses by creating new demand in uncontested market space. OIC has explored and developed new markets and acted as the creator of “Blue Ocean”.
By opening specialised websites, OIC has brought useful technological references to customers. One typical such site is http://cisco.oic.com.vn - the No. 1 specialized network equipment and solution site in Vietnam.
Innovative technological and social projects
In 2010, OIC stirred up the ICT world with E Corporate Banking software, a top-tier software for electronic corporate banking systems. This product has been rated four-star by the National Council of Sao Khue Award 2010. This software product will provide the best application system for banks, allowing them to diversify internet-based business activities.
OIC Hospital Software, also a Sao Khue Award winner in 2006, is being applied in many large hospitals, with user-friendly features and interface.
Apart from investing in network transmission laboratories and social-benefit IT solutions, Luu Hai Minh is building and deploying innovative, even unprecedented, technological and social projects in Vietnam. OIC has developed and produced supporting and training equipment for autistic children, especially building the capital-intensive OIC Hyperactivity Institute, with the aim of treating hyperactivity disorder in children.
Along with social projects, CEO Luu Hai Minh also pushes green technology projects, particularly high-tech wastewater treatment projects and desalination systems for offshore military bases.
Minh said: “My business philosophy is absolutely innovative. OIC must always be a leader in exploring new market spaces and creating new products.” He is also ambitiously applying wind power technology to tap an inexhaustible energy source.
With its persevering efforts, OIC has won many awards such as ISO Gold Cups in 2007, 2008 and 2009, Strong Trademark Super Cup, 50 Intellectual Property Products Gold Cup, Vietnam Golden Lotus Award and Sao Khue Awards.
